摘要:
High compression rate codecs in gateways servicing Voice-over-Internet Protocol (VoIP) and Voice Band Data (VBD) calls distort modem/fax Answer Back Tones (e.g., 2100 Hz), which may lead to signal distortion and call hang-ups. To prevent such occurrences, a method or corresponding apparatus forces originating and terminating gateways to stay in a low complexity non-voice compression codec (e.g., ITU G.711) after prenegotiating a high complexity, voice compression codec (e.g., G.729 or G.726) during a short beginning period of a voice call. The low complexity codec avoids distorted answer back tone leakage associated with previous solutions that use a notch filter to block the leakage, thereby significantly improving the success rate of a VBD call by completely eliminating modem answer back tone distortion caused by high complexity codecs that use voice compression and by completely eliminating use of the notch filter.
摘要:
A testing and performance analysis methodology applies a series of test vector pairs to the input ports of an echo canceller under test. The test vector signal pair may represent a particular speech activity state transition, e.g., a Brady Model transition. A scoring compression function such as a sigmoid squashing function is used to evaluate quantized performance parameters. The sub-scores may be weighted and averaged to provide an overall performance score.
摘要:
A system in a Voice Over Internet Protocol (VOIP) network eliminates false voice detection in voice band data service (e.g., modem or facsimile transmission) by sequentially enabling silence detection then voice detection. In Voice Band Data (VBD) mode, the system initially enables silence detection and disables voice detection. If silence is detected in a VOIP signal associated with a VOIP call, the system enables voice detection. If voice is detected, the system switches from VBD mode to voice mode and enables processing (e.g., echo cancellation and/or data compression) that improves voice communications.
摘要:
A method, or corresponding apparatus, assumes a call is a Voice Band Data (VBD) call. The method disables a local echo canceller and transmits a tone that disables distal echo canceller(s) along a communications path across which the call is communicated. After disabling the echo cancellers, the echo cancellers are allowed to operate in a typical manner, such as according to ITU standards, after the call is established, including remaining disabled if the call is a Voice Band Data call and being automatically enabled if the call is or becomes a voice call. The method or apparatus is particularly useful in networks having Point of Service (POS) devices that have modems that do not send out a 2100 Hz tone to disable echo cancelling in the communications path. In one embodiment, the method or corresponding apparatus is deployed in a gateway.